Job Description:

Elsewhere Entertainment is looking for a talented Senior+ Engine Programmer to drive the creation of innovative systems and technologies for our next-generation AAA experiences on our new IP.

We’re hiring at multiple levels of seniority - whether you’re a seasoned Senior Engineer or an experienced Principal looking to shape foundational engine systems, we want to hear from you.

In this role, you will implement complex technical systems and help drive the technical direction of our projects, ensuring that our games deliver exceptional experiences to players around the world. Together we foster a culture of excellence, innovation, and collaboration by actively sharing technical expertise with the team, including non-technical colleagues, and help deliver cutting-edge tools and solutions that push the boundaries of what is possible in gaming.

You’ll help us by…

  • Implementing, maintaining and optimizing engine systems with a focus on performance and scalability. More senior candidates are expected to take end-to-end ownership of complex systems, from prototype to final result.
  • Improving our technology stack for next-gen development and future platforms.
  • Working with stakeholders to translate creative ideas into software.
  • Collaborate with peers, fostering a culture of learning and technical excellence.
  • Communicating technical considerations and trade-offs and how those align with project goals, inspiring and guiding your peers and stakeholders.
  • Anticipating challenges and risks and implementing innovative and preventative solutions.

You’re awesome because you have…

  • 4+ years as a professional programmer or a combination of education and relevant experience. Led the design and implementation of large-scale systems with significant complexity and cross-disciplinary impact.
  • With increasing seniority, increasingly deep expertise with:
  • C/C++, 3D math, common data structures, and algorithms.
  • Profiling and optimization.
  • Code robustness and testability
  • One or more areas such as game/tools UI/UX, VFX, online systems, physics, rendering, vehicles, or open-world streaming.
  • Experience with modular architecture, event-driven systems, design patterns, and object-oriented programming principles.
  • Ability to work effectively with both internally and externally developed codebases.
  • A strong commitment to writing clean, maintainable, portable, and optimized code.
  • A proven track record of contributing to one or more shipped AAA games.
